смотрят
98 студентов

Описание

Что вы изучите?

  • Основы iOS Контроль версий с Git и Github Swift 3 Objective-C Продвинутый Objective-C

Требования

  • ПК или ноутбук с Mac на OSX Подключение к Интернету
  • NFT Certificate
  • 223 Количество лекций
  • Начальный
  • English
  • 4.9 Рейтинг
  • +100 XP

Share Course on Social media

Содержание

Course consist of total 56ч 11м of content, in total.

Раздел 1: Начало знакомства с iOS 10 и Swift 3
46:42
Раздел 2: Обучение Swift 3
3:34:41
Переменные операторы и как работают компьютеры
16:48
Swift3 Строки
15:22
Swift3 Числа
19:53
Swift3 Функции
22:39
Swift3 Булевы типы и условная логика
20:57
Swift3 Константы и логические операторы
10:27
Swift3 Массивы
13:06
Swift3 Циклы
18:59
Swift3 Словари
18:44
Swift Опционалы: Xcode 8 обновления
01:04
Swift Опционалы
28:01
Объектно-ориентированное программирование
12:00
Наследование
08:19
Полиморфизм
08:22
Раздел 3: Контроль версий с Git и Github
1:27:32
Git и контроль версий - простой способ
11:59
Основы работы с терминалом - Изменение каталогов
06:07
Основы работы с терминалом - Копирование и переименование файлов
08:57
Основы работы с терминалом - Создание каталогов и файлов
04:30
Основы работы с терминалом - Удаление файлов и каталогов
06:01
Основы Git
17:16
Настройка Github
04:36
Локальные и удалённые репозитории Git
11:14
Работа с конфликтами в Git
16:52
Раздел 4: Основы iOS
6:05:31
Приложение iOS 10: Miracle Pills - Xcode 8 Обновления
00:47
Приложение iOS 10: Miracle Pills 01 - Autolayout и создание проекта
14:48
Приложение iOS 10: Miracle Pills 02 - Ширина, высота, ведущие и замыкающие ограничения
21:19
Приложение iOS 10: Miracle Pills 03 - UIPickerView
28:49
Работа с UIScrollView
28:45
Работа с UIStackview
39:36
Смена экранов с Segues - Xcode 8 Обновления
03:06
Смена экранов с Segues
26:30
Приложение iOS 10: Retro Calculator - Введение
01:04
Приложение iOS 10: Retro Calculator - Xcode 8 Обновления
03:02
Приложение iOS 10: Retro Calculator - UIStackView и auto layout
34:53
Приложение iOS 10: Retro Calculator - Пользовательский шрифт на iOS 10
02:41
Приложение iOS 10: Retro Calculator - Проигрывание аудио файлов на iOS 10
08:00
Приложение iOS 10: Retro Calculator - Математика и логика
17:29
Упражнение - Улучшение калькулятора
01:52
Классы размера в iOS 10 и Xcode 8
18:03
Приложение iOS 10: Party Rock - Введение
01:43
Приложение iOS 10: Party Rock - Xcode 8 Обновления
02:05
Приложение iOS 10: Party Rock - Дизайн UI
17:24
Приложение iOS 10: Party Rock - Пользовательские ячейки таблицы и моделирование данных
22:39
Приложение iOS 10: Party Rock - Скачивание изображений и async
09:21
Приложение iOS 10: Party Rock - Показ YouTube видео в Web View MVC
09:28
MVC
26:46
Создание полоски статуса в PaintCode
25:21
Раздел 5: Работа с REST и веб-запросами в iOS 10 и Swift 3
7:37:01
Как веб-запросы работают в iOS 10
17:51
JSON в iOS 10
10:33
Приложение iOS 10: Rainy Shine - Xcode 8 Обновления
07:00
Приложение iOS 10: Rainy Shine - Введение и создание проекта
03:28
Приложение iOS 10: Rainy Shine - Введение в Cocoapods
06:13
Приложение iOS 10: Rainy Shine - Установка Cocoapods и Alamofire
05:56
Приложение iOS 10: Rainy Shine - Создание интерфейса в IBOutlets
32:25
Приложение iOS 10: Rainy Shine - Table view, delegate и datasource
11:37
Приложение iOS 10: Rainy Shine - Регистрация OpenWeather API
10:09
Приложение iOS 10: Rainy Shine - Модели данных и константы
20:09
Скачивание данных из API с помощью Alamofire
13:06
Приложение iOS 10: Rainy Shine - Разбор данных JSON
16:12
Приложение iOS 10: Rainy Shine - Обновление UI с помощью данных из API
08:11
Приложение iOS 10: Rainy Shine - Моделирование данных и инициализация словаря
40:00
Приложение iOS 10: Rainy Shine - IBOutlets и ячейка пользовательской погоды
15:36
Приложение iOS 10: Rainy Shine - Местоположение пользователя с помощью CLLocationManager
27:13
Приложение iOS 10: Pokedex - Введение в приложение
01:15
Приложение iOS 10: Pokedex - Xcode 8 Обновления
06:26
Приложение iOS 10: Pokedex - Настройка проекта, изображения, данные и Github
08:16
Приложение iOS 10: Pokedex - Создание класса Pokemon
04:36
Приложение iOS 10: Pokedex - Макет Collection view, storyboard
08:52
Приложение iOS 10: Pokedex - Ячейка пользовательского collection view
07:38
Приложение iOS 10: Pokedex - Collection view delegate, источник данных и макет порядка
13:02
Приложение iOS 10: Pokedex - Разбор файлов CSV
12:52
Приложение iOS 10: Pokedex - Аудио и пользовательские шрифты
12:23
Приложение iOS 10: Pokedex - Панель поиска и фильтр
15:27
Приложение iOS 10: Pokedex - Detail controller и segue
10:04
Приложение iOS 10: Pokedex - Stack view и detail view controller
23:13
Приложение iOS 10: Pokedex - IBOutlets и изменения модели
06:02
Приложение iOS 10: Pokedex - API, Github, Cocoapods и Alamofire
07:22
Приложение iOS 10: Pokedex - Скачивание и разбор данных Часть 1
29:19
Приложение iOS 10: Pokedex - Скачивание и разбор данных Часть 2
16:04
Приложение iOS 10: Pokedex - Завершение работы над Pokedex
28:31
Раздел 6: Понятия Data Persistence и Core Data
3:16:36
Введение приложение Core Data
01:22
Зачем использовать Core Data
03:54
Обзор архитектуры Core Data
03:59
Приложение iOS 10: DreamLister Часть 1 - Создание модели данных
20:30
Приложение iOS 10: DreamLister Часть 2 - Дизайн View
20:59
Приложение iOS 10: DreamLister Часть 3 - Подключение View
06:09
Приложение iOS 10: DreamLister Часть 4 - NSFetchedResultsController
22:22
Приложение iOS 10: DreamLister Часть 5 - Получение и отображение данных
16:59
Приложение iOS 10: DreamLister Часть 6 - Экран деталей
14:53
Приложение iOS 10: DreamLister Часть 7 - Внедрение UIPickerView
13:39
Приложение iOS 10: DreamLister Часть 8 - Сохранение данных из формы
13:34
Приложение iOS 10: DreamLister Часть 9 - Редактирование существующих данных
16:28
Приложение iOS 10: DreamLister Часть 10 - Удаление и добавление изображений
18:47
Приложение iOS 10: DreamLister Часть 11 - Сортировка данных
06:56
Приложение iOS 10: DreamLister Часть 12 - Испытание ItemType
02:27
Приложение iOS 10: Конвертация проекта Core Data из Swift 2 в Swift 3
13:38
Раздел 7: Протокол-ориентированное программирование и продвинутый Swift 3
2:39:55
Введение в протокол-ориентированное программирование
11:08
Написание ваших первых протоколов
20:25
Создание расширений протоколов
14:53
Генерики и протоколы
13:37
Введение в протокол-ориентированное программирование
02:44
Практические примеры использования протокол-ориентированного программирования
1:23:20
Рекурсивные функции
13:48
Раздел 8: Новые функции iOS 10
1:44:24
iOS 10: Расширения для приложения стикеров iMessage
06:19
iOS 10: API распознавания речи
46:45
iOS 10: Уведомления пользователей - Xcode 8 Обновление
05:47
iOS 10: Уведомления пользователей
45:33
Раздел 9: Создание приложений с помощью Firebase
1:08:09
Введение в Firebase
06:35
Firebase Всплывающие уведомления - Создание проекта
05:33
Firebase Всплывающие уведомления - Создание push cert
07:00
Firebase Всплывающие уведомления - Подключение с помощью кода к Firebase
17:47
Сортировка данных в Firebase - Xcode 8 Обновления
02:33
Сортировка данных в Firebase
28:41
Раздел 10: Карты, GPS, геолокация, Pokemon и Firebase
1:19:47
Приложение iOS 10: PokeFinder - Введение
02:45
Приложение iOS 10: PokeFinder - Xcode 8 Обновления
02:01
Приложение iOS 10: PokeFinder - Установка Firebase и GeoFire
13:02
Приложение iOS 10: PokeFinder - Пользовательское изображение для местоположения пользователя
16:34
Приложение iOS 10: PokeFinder - Сохранение покемона на местоположении GPS
19:05
Приложение iOS 10: PokeFinder - Показ аннотаций покемона на карте
18:10
Приложение iOS 10: PokeFinder - Разрешения локации и завершение приложени
08:10
Раздел 11: Создание социальной сети с Firebase
9:52:11
Приложение iOS 10: Social Network - Введение
03:40
Приложение iOS 10: Social Network - Xcode 8 Обновления
11:51
Приложение iOS 10: Social Network - Настройка Firebase
37:22
Приложение iOS 10: Social Network - UI входа
33:39
Приложение iOS 10: Social Network - Пользовательские View
28:45
Приложение iOS 10: Social Network - Аутентификация с Facebook
45:05
Приложение iOS 10: Social Network - Аутентификация с помощью электронной почты в Firebase
19:45
Приложение iOS 10: Social Network - Автоматический вход
39:18
Приложение iOS 10: Social Network - UI для ленты новостей
49:16
Приложение iOS 10: Social Network - Таблица с пользовательскими ячейками для ленты
22:08
Приложение iOS 10: Social Network - Моделирование данных и архитектура Firebase
29:49
Приложение iOS 10: Social Network - Создание пользователей базы данных для Firebase
41:17
Приложение iOS 10: Social Network - База данных Firebase
18:29
Приложение iOS 10: Social Network - Разбор данных Firebase
26:28
Приложение iOS 10: Social Network - Данные Firebase в UI
13:05
Приложение iOS 10: Social Network - UIPickerView запись в Firebase
20:54
Приложение iOS 10: Social Network - Введение в хранилище Firebase
11:44
Приложение iOS 10: Social Network - Скачивание файлов из хранилища Firebase
30:56
Приложение iOS 10: Social Network - Загрузка файлов в Firebase
29:23
Приложение iOS 10: Social Network - Создание записи в социальной сети
19:27
Приложение iOS 10: Social Network - Отношения базы данных Firebase
48:26
Приложение iOS 10: Social Network - Упражнение
11:24
Раздел 12: Продвинутый уровень: Создание клона Snapchat с помощью Firebase
4:03:42
Приложение iOS 10: DevChat - Xcode 8 Обновления
08:14
Приложение iOS 10: DevChat - Создание проекта и использование примера кода Apple
16:43
Приложение iOS 10: DevChat - Рефакторинг кода Apple и перемещение IBOutlets
13:03
Приложение iOS 10: DevChat - Перемещение код из родительского класса в дочерний
05:19
Приложение iOS 10: DevChat - Как создать свой собственный протокол и делегат
25:50
Приложение iOS 10: DevChat - Установка и настройка Firebase
05:28
Приложение iOS 10: DevChat - Моделирование данных и структура приложения в Firebase
22:44
Приложение iOS 10: DevChat - Пользовательский View с помощью IBDesignable и IBInspectable
27:35
Приложение iOS 10: DevChat - UI входа и аутентификация Firebase
09:16
Приложение iOS 10: DevChat - Как сохранить аутентифицированных пользователей в Firebase
19:24
Приложение iOS 10: DevChat - Обработка ошибок аутентификации Firebase
18:36
Приложение iOS 10: DevChat - Как сохранить аутентифицированных пользователей в Firebase
12:46
Приложение iOS 10: DevChat - Скачивание и разбор пользователей Firebase
39:10
Приложение iOS 10: DevChat - Отправка вашего первого снапа
11:33
Создание скриншотов для App Store
08:01
Раздел 13: Как создать мобильное приложение с помощью Sketch
1:46:13
Обзор UI Sketch
02:06
Дизайн вашего первого приложения в Sketch
12:15
Базовые слои
11:11
Разбор форм
16:16
Маскинг и пропорциональное масштабирование
07:46
Создание экрана настроек в Sketch
15:57
Стилизация в Sketch Часть 2
12:29
Работа с изображениями
07:12
Типография и текст
05:29
Символы
10:51
Как производить экспорт графики
04:41
Раздел 14: Дизайн чат-приложения в Sketch
1:59:42
Введение
00:33
Создание экрана регистрации и входа
19:24
Создание почтового ящика
37:44
Новые сообщения UI
23:06
Создание UI чата
19:42
Создание экрана настроек
19:13
Раздел 15: Дизайн приложения социальной сети в Sketch
32:34
Введение
00:32
Создание UI регистрации с помощью электронной почты
07:43
Дизайн главного экрана
24:19
Раздел 16: Objective-C и Swift 3: Начало работы
1:22:37
Создание приложения для iOS в Objective-C
05:48
Анатомия файла Objective-C
09:26
Objective-C Свойства и переменные образца
11:07
Objective-C Геттеры и сеттеры
12:09
Objective-C Указатели
05:53